Do you really think the interest in the Hawkeye and Black Widow comics is being driven by the movies as opposed to what's on the page? Any store owners I've asked have always said that movies/TV shows don't drive comic sales much. Walking Dead is probably the exception to the rule.

Yes. Of course. Absolutely.

There are exponentially more people interested in Hawkeye and the Black Widow today than there were a few movies ago. And that interest translates into potential sales for a HAWKEYE or WIDOW series. By itself that’s not enough to guarantee the success of such a book–you still need to deliver the goods to that audience. But the basic bar of interest for both of those characters is much, much greater than it’s ever been before.
